Chipotle Mexican Grill (NYSE:CMG) Shares Down 1.6%

Chipotle Mexican Grill, Inc. (NYSE:CMGGet Free Report)’s stock price dropped 1.6% during mid-day trading on Wednesday . The company traded as low as $57.53 and last traded at $57.56. Approximately 1,823,227 shares traded hands during mid-day trading, a decline of 88% from the average daily volume of 14,727,790 shares. The stock had previously closed at $58.50.

Chipotle Mexican Grill Stock Performance

The business’s 50-day moving average is $54.29 and its 200-day moving average is $81.15. The company has a market capitalization of $79.05 billion, a PE ratio of 61.23, a PEG ratio of 2.33 and a beta of 1.25.

Chipotle Mexican Grill (NYSE:CMGG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, July 24th. The restaurant operator reported $0.34 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.32 by $0.02. Chipotle Mexican Grill had a return on equity of 44.01% and a net margin of 13.23%. The firm had revenue of $2.97 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$2.94 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$12.65 EPS.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 18.2% compared to the same quarter last year. Analysts expect that Chipotle Mexican Grill, Inc. will post 1.08 EPS for the current year.

About Chipotle Mexican Grill

Chipotle Mexican Grill,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, owns and operates Chipotle Mexican Grill restaurants. It sells food and beverages through offering burritos, burrito bowls, quesadillas, tacos, and salads. The company also provides delivery and related services its app and website. It has operations in the United States, Canada, France, Germany, and the United Kingdom.
